Details

Time bar (total: 43.4s)

sample220.0ms

Algorithm
intervals
Results
163.0ms525×body80valid

simplify201.0ms

Counts
1 → 1
Calls
1 calls:
Slowest
201.0ms
(- (- (+ (- (* (* (* (* x 18.0) y) z) t) (* (* a 4.0) t)) (* b c)) (* (* x 4.0) i)) (* (* j 27.0) k))

prune39.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 2.9b

localize46.0ms

Local error

Found 4 expressions with local error:

5.3b
(* y (* (* x 18.0) z))
2.9b
(* (- (* y (* (* x 18.0) z)) (* a 4.0)) t)
0.2b
(* (* 27.0 j) k)
0.2b
(* (* x 18.0) z)

rewrite316.0ms

Algorithm
rewrite-expression-head
Rules
25×pow1 add-cbrt-cube add-exp-log
13×pow-prod-down prod-exp cbrt-unprod
11×add-sqr-sqrt
10×associate-*r*
*-un-lft-identity add-cube-cbrt
associate-*l*
*-commutative insert-posit16 add-log-exp
associate-*l/
flip3-- flip-- unswap-sqr
Counts
4 → 81
Calls
4 calls:
Slowest
215.0ms
(* (- (* y (* (* x 18.0) z)) (* a 4.0)) t)
46.0ms
(* y (* (* x 18.0) z))
27.0ms
(* (* x 18.0) z)
26.0ms
(* (* 27.0 j) k)

series222.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
127.0ms
(* (- (* y (* (* x 18.0) z)) (* a 4.0)) t)
46.0ms
(* y (* (* x 18.0) z))
27.0ms
(* (* x 18.0) z)
21.0ms
(* (* 27.0 j) k)

simplify6.2s

Counts
50 → 93
Calls
50 calls:
Slowest
880.0ms
(* (* (* (- (* y (* (* x 18.0) z)) (* a 4.0)) (- (* y (* (* x 18.0) z)) (* a 4.0))) (- (* y (* (* x 18.0) z)) (* a 4.0))) (* (* t t) t))
630.0ms
(* (* (* (* x 18.0) (* x 18.0)) (* x 18.0)) (* (* z z) z))
519.0ms
(* (* (* (* 27.0 j) (* 27.0 j)) (* 27.0 j)) (* (* k k) k))
500.0ms
(* (* (* (* x x) x) (* (* 18.0 18.0) 18.0)) (* (* z z) z))
394.0ms
(* (* (* (* 27.0 27.0) 27.0) (* (* j j) j)) (* (* k k) k))

prune2.1s

Pruning

6 alts after pruning (6 fresh and 0 done)

Merged error: 2.6b

localize54.0ms

Local error

Found 4 expressions with local error:

5.4b
(* (* x z) (* y 18.0))
2.9b
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
0.2b
(* (* 27.0 j) k)
0.0b
(- (* (* x z) (* y 18.0)) (* 4.0 a))

rewrite173.0ms

Algorithm
rewrite-expression-head
Rules
23×pow1 add-cbrt-cube add-exp-log
12×pow-prod-down prod-exp cbrt-unprod
add-sqr-sqrt
*-un-lft-identity associate-*r* add-cube-cbrt
add-log-exp
associate-*l*
insert-posit16
sub-neg *-commutative
distribute-rgt-in distribute-lft-in flip3-- associate-*r/ flip--
diff-log unswap-sqr
Counts
4 → 80
Calls
4 calls:
Slowest
98.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
31.0ms
(- (* (* x z) (* y 18.0)) (* 4.0 a))
29.0ms
(* (* x z) (* y 18.0))
14.0ms
(* (* 27.0 j) k)

series364.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
184.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
108.0ms
(- (* (* x z) (* y 18.0)) (* 4.0 a))
47.0ms
(* (* x z) (* y 18.0))
25.0ms
(* (* 27.0 j) k)

simplify5.6s

Counts
49 → 92
Calls
49 calls:
Slowest
837.0ms
(* (* (* (* 27.0 27.0) 27.0) (* (* j j) j)) (* (* k k) k))
549.0ms
(* (* (* (* 27.0 j) (* 27.0 j)) (* 27.0 j)) (* (* k k) k))
350.0ms
(/ (exp (* (* x z) (* y 18.0))) (exp (* 4.0 a)))
319.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))
316.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))

prune2.0s

Pruning

5 alts after pruning (5 fresh and 0 done)

Merged error: 2.6b

localize58.0ms

Local error

Found 4 expressions with local error:

5.4b
(* (* x z) (* y 18.0))
2.9b
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
0.3b
(* 27.0 (* j k))
0.0b
(- (* c b) (+ (* 27.0 (* j k)) (* (* x 4.0) i)))

rewrite208.0ms

Algorithm
rewrite-expression-head
Rules
23×pow1 add-cbrt-cube add-exp-log
12×pow-prod-down prod-exp cbrt-unprod
add-sqr-sqrt add-log-exp
*-un-lft-identity associate-*l* add-cube-cbrt
associate-*r*
insert-posit16
sub-neg *-commutative
distribute-rgt-in distribute-lft-in flip3-- diff-log associate-*r/ flip--
sum-log associate--r+ unswap-sqr
Counts
4 → 82
Calls
4 calls:
Slowest
110.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
42.0ms
(* (* x z) (* y 18.0))
40.0ms
(- (* c b) (+ (* 27.0 (* j k)) (* (* x 4.0) i)))
14.0ms
(* 27.0 (* j k))

series357.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
171.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
125.0ms
(- (* c b) (+ (* 27.0 (* j k)) (* (* x 4.0) i)))
37.0ms
(* (* x z) (* y 18.0))
23.0ms
(* 27.0 (* j k))

simplify5.5s

Counts
51 → 94
Calls
51 calls:
Slowest
516.0ms
(* (* (* 27.0 27.0) 27.0) (* (* (* j k) (* j k)) (* j k)))
415.0ms
(* (* (* 27.0 27.0) 27.0) (* (* (* j j) j) (* (* k k) k)))
316.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))
300.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))
275.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))

prune2.1s

Pruning

5 alts after pruning (5 fresh and 0 done)

Merged error: 2.6b

localize94.0ms

Local error

Found 4 expressions with local error:

5.4b
(* (* x z) (* y 18.0))
2.9b
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
0.2b
(* (sqrt 27.0) (* (sqrt 27.0) (* j k)))
0.2b
(* (sqrt 27.0) (* j k))

rewrite312.0ms

Algorithm
rewrite-expression-head
Rules
32×pow1 add-cbrt-cube add-exp-log
18×pow-prod-down prod-exp cbrt-unprod
16×associate-*l*
12×add-sqr-sqrt
10×*-un-lft-identity add-cube-cbrt
associate-*r* sqrt-prod
*-commutative insert-posit16 add-log-exp
distribute-rgt-in sub-neg distribute-lft-in associate-*r/
flip3-- flip-- unswap-sqr
Counts
4 → 95
Calls
4 calls:
Slowest
162.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
75.0ms
(* (sqrt 27.0) (* (sqrt 27.0) (* j k)))
42.0ms
(* (* x z) (* y 18.0))
30.0ms
(* (sqrt 27.0) (* j k))

series381.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
162.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
104.0ms
(* (sqrt 27.0) (* (sqrt 27.0) (* j k)))
60.0ms
(* (sqrt 27.0) (* j k))
55.0ms
(* (* x z) (* y 18.0))

simplify5.9s

Counts
66 → 107
Calls
66 calls:
Slowest
406.0ms
(* (* (* (sqrt 27.0) (sqrt 27.0)) (sqrt 27.0)) (* (* (* j k) (* j k)) (* j k)))
329.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))
325.0ms
(- (* 18.0 (* t (* x (* z y)))) (* 4.0 (* a t)))
231.0ms
(* t (- (* (* x z) (* y 18.0)) (* 4.0 a)))
229.0ms
(* (* (* (sqrt 27.0) (sqrt 27.0)) (sqrt 27.0)) (* (* (* j j) j) (* (* k k) k)))

prune2.5s

Pruning

5 alts after pruning (5 fresh and 0 done)

Merged error: 2.6b

regimes2.0s

Accuracy

0% (2.9b remaining)

Error of 4.7b against oracle of 1.9b and baseline of 4.7b

bsearch5.0ms

end0.0ms

sample6.3s

Algorithm
intervals
Results
5.0s16198×body80valid